The situation in Ukraine's occupied territories of Crimea and Donbas remains tense as Russian forces maintain their control, leading to a complex humanitarian and geopolitical crisis. Reports have surfaced of Russian military fortifications, large-scale investments in infrastructure, and systematic efforts to integrate these regions into Russia's economic sphere. Ukrainian officials, including President Zelenskyy, have voiced concerns over the humanitarian disasters unfolding in areas like Oleshky, as residents endure severe shortages of essentials such as electricity and medicine. The international community is being urged to document alleged crimes and violations. Meanwhile, diplomatic discussions continue, with Ukraine steadfast in its refusal to compromise on territorial integrity, as reaffirmed by various international bodies. Despite the ongoing conflict, Ukraine's defense forces execute targeted operations against military infrastructure in these regions, striving to weaken the occupying forces' hold and signal resilience in the face of occupation.

What is the current situation in the occupied territories of Ukraine?

The occupied territories of Ukraine, including Crimea and Donbas, are under significant strain due to Russian control. Local populations are facing dire humanitarian conditions, with reports of shortages in electricity, gas, food, and medical supplies. The geopolitical situation remains tense, with continuous efforts by Russia to integrate these regions into its economic and political framework. Ukrainian authorities, alongside international organizations, are calling for increased monitoring and intervention to address the humanitarian crisis and uphold Ukraine's territorial integrity.

How is Ukraine responding to the occupation of its territories by Russia?

Ukraine is actively resisting the occupation of its territories by Russia through diplomatic and military means. Ukrainian forces routinely conduct targeted operations to undermine the military capabilities of the occupying forces. Diplomatically, Ukraine remains firm in its stance against recognizing the occupation and continues to engage with international partners to seek support and reinforce its sovereignty. The government also emphasizes the importance of humanitarian aid and the documentation of occupation-related human rights violations.
